首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

postgresql -错误:连接已终止

PostgreSQL是一种开源的关系型数据库管理系统(RDBMS),它具有稳定性、可靠性和高性能的特点。它支持多种操作系统,并提供了丰富的功能和灵活的扩展性。

错误:连接已终止是指在与PostgreSQL数据库建立的连接中发生了异常,导致连接被意外地关闭或终止。这可能是由于网络故障、数据库服务器故障、连接超时或其他原因引起的。

为了解决这个问题,可以采取以下几个步骤:

  1. 检查网络连接:确保客户端和数据库服务器之间的网络连接是稳定的。可以尝试使用其他网络工具(如ping)测试网络连接的稳定性。
  2. 检查数据库服务器状态:确认数据库服务器是否正常运行,并且没有出现任何错误或异常。可以查看数据库服务器的日志文件以获取更多信息。
  3. 检查连接超时设置:如果连接超时时间设置过短,可能会导致连接被意外地关闭。可以尝试增加连接超时时间,以确保连接能够保持活动状态。
  4. 检查数据库连接池设置:如果使用了数据库连接池,确保连接池的配置正确,并且连接池没有达到最大连接数限制。
  5. 检查数据库配置:检查数据库服务器的配置文件,确保没有配置错误或不一致的地方。特别是,检查max_connections参数是否设置得足够大以支持所需的连接数。
  6. 更新数据库驱动程序:如果使用的是特定编程语言的数据库驱动程序,尝试更新到最新版本,以确保驱动程序没有已知的连接问题。

腾讯云提供了云数据库 PostgreSQL(TencentDB for PostgreSQL)服务,它是基于PostgreSQL的托管式数据库解决方案。它提供了高可用性、弹性扩展、自动备份和恢复等功能,适用于各种应用场景。您可以通过以下链接了解更多关于腾讯云 PostgreSQL 的信息:

产品介绍链接:https://cloud.tencent.com/product/postgresql

总结:在处理postgresql连接已终止错误时,需要综合考虑网络连接、数据库服务器状态、连接超时设置、数据库连接池设置、数据库配置和数据库驱动程序等因素。腾讯云的云数据库 PostgreSQL 提供了一种可靠的解决方案,适用于各种应用场景。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

16分41秒

PostgreSQL连接池管理工具pgbouncer

1分21秒

11、mysql系列之许可更新及对象搜索

-

中国5G手机用户已达到3.1亿户

-

我国5G发牌两周年 累计建成5G基站81.9万个 手机终端连接数达3.1亿

55秒

VS无线采集仪读取振弦传感器频率值为零的常见原因

领券